
Formation of NGO
as a Society
Any seven or more like
minded persons associated for charitable purpose may form Society or NPO under
The Societies Registration Act, 1860. Charitable purposes may include promotion
of literature, science or fine arts or diffusion of useful knowledge i.e. management
of libraries, public museums, galleries of paintings or works of art, schools,
dispensaries, rural centres or population welfare facilities, water supply and
sanitation faculties.
